Disease that can be detected from the condition of the hand

Some diseases that can be seen from the condition and health of your hands include:

1. Hands trembling for signs of Parkinson's disease

Drinking too much coffee, taking asthma or antidepressant medications, and fatigue can make your hands tremble. However, if your hands tremble for no apparent reason even when you are resting, you need to be vigilant.

Most likely the condition is a symptom of Parkinson's disease. In addition to tremors, Parkinson's disease will cause other symptoms, such as muscle stiffness and slower than normal body movements, decreased writing and speaking ability, and difficulty maintaining body balance.

2. Pale skin and nails are a sign of anemia

All types of anemia can cause discoloration of the skin and your nails become paler, why? Anemia indicates that the body cannot produce oxygen-rich red blood properly. Insufficient red blood cell needs make the face until the nails become pale.

In addition to discoloration of the skin of the hands and nails, anemia causes other symptoms such as the body easily fatigued, bruises on the skin, easily injured and difficult blood to clot, and leg cramps.

3. Red palms are a sign of liver disease

Reddened palms can occur when your hands are pressed or pressed for a long time. However, it can also be a symptom of liver disease, namely liver cirrhosis. The condition of blushing the palm of the hand is also called palmar eritrema.

Besides palmar eritrema, blood spots called purpura can also appear. These spots are purplish red about the size of a pin, formed by proteins in the blood clot due to cold weather and blocking blood flow.

4. Bloated fingertips signs of lung and heart disease

Clubbed nails is the shape of a nail that protrudes or bubbles at the edges. Bubbling of the fingertips is caused by low oxygen levels in the blood. These finger nail deformities can be caused by various diseases, generally lung and heart disease.

5. The fingertips turn blue marks of Raynaud's phenomenon

The fingertip that changes color can indicate Raynaud's phenomenon. Raynaud's phenomenon is reduced blood flow to the fingers, toes, tip of the nose, or ears.

In addition to discoloration, this condition can cause symptoms of numbness or a sensation of sharp objects. Initially the normal skin color turns white, in a few moments it turns blue and feels cold.

When blood circulation has improved again, the cold skin area becomes warmer. Skin color will return to normal.
